Establishing the environmentally safe width of protective riparian zone along water bodies

Abstract

Aim. Establishing protective riparian zonesalong the riversides of the Shopurka river inside water protection zones at the territory of urban settlement Velykyy Bytchkiv for protecting surface water bodies from polluting and littering, as well as for saving their water content. The aim of the research is determining the safe protective riparian zonesof water bodies taking into account ecological factors. Methods. The research methodology consists in using the algorithm of determining the width of the protective riparian zone, which enables providing the science-baseddetermination of the width of the protective riparian zone of the water body depending on the types of sylva, granulometric composition of soils, slope expositionand type of soil treatment. Results. The proposed method of determining the optimal width of protective riparian allows justifying the topicality and necessity of its application. For the given river, the width of protective riparian has been determined according to the requirements of Water code of Ukraine and calculated in accordance with formula (1). It will allow the elimination of ambiguity of the determining the width of the protective riparian by the calculations made by the representatives of local water economy with the use of Water code of Ukraine and will facilitate the univocal determining the areas of protective riparian zones. Scientific topicality. Realization of the method of determining the width of the protective riparian according to the proposed algorithm and actual legal documents has shown that the aberration of the protective riparian along the river Shopurka is equal to 20 m. The area of the protective riparian according to the Water code equals 1.82 ha, but according to formula (1) is equal to 3.29 ha. Therefore, the total area of the protective riparian zone should be expandedby 1.47 ha. Practical importance. Determined area and boundaries of the protective riparian zones along the river Shopurka (Zakarpatsky region) will enable the systematic monitoring of the use of riparian soils to be conducted and facilitate the improvement of ecological and sanitary state of the river.
